A magnet is an object made of a ferromagnetic material such as iron, cobalt, or nickel that creates a magnetic field. Ferromagnetic materials are materials that are easily magnetized. The force with which a magnet attracts or repels iron is called the magnetic force.
Magnets have long been a popular refrigerator accessory. In most cases they are round and made of plastic with a metal ring in the middle. Magnets can be purchased in a variety of shapes, colors and sizes, and are often printed with words or images. They're an easy way to decorate the fridge while doing something meaningful. Magnets can hold different things, for example: notes, photos, magazines, postcards, shopping lists or children's drawings.

The most important thing about magnets at a glance
Magnets are very practical helpers in the household and can be used for many different purposes. For example, they can be used to attach paper or other objects to the wall or refrigerator door. Magnets can also be very useful for keeping things organized.
However, one should also consider some disadvantages of magnets in the house. For one thing, magnets can affect some sensitive technical devices such as hard drives. On the other hand, they are not suitable for all objects, as they can damage them. Before you use magnets in your household, you should be well informed and consider whether you actually need them.
